Algebra, present and past

What is algebra? Algebra is one of many branches of mathematics. This branch of mathematics used mathematical equations to describe the relationship between two things that can change during a period of time. Whenever a mathematical equation to represent something that fluctuates and does not stay the same, letters or symbols are often used to represent variable quantity. The letter or symbol is called a variable because it varies.

The beginning of modern algebra began with the ancient Babylonians. They were the first who used a mathematical system ahead of its time.
